Applied Linguistics and Multilingualism B.A. Transfer Requirements: Folsom Lake CollegeUC Santa Cruz

The official course articulation for transferring into UC Santa Cruz’s Applied Linguistics and Multilingualism B.A. major from Folsom Lake College — i.e. exactly which Folsom Lake College courses satisfy each UC Santa Cruz major-preparation requirement, per ASSIST.org (2025–26).

Required courses (Folsom Lake CollegeUC Santa Cruz)

LING 50
5 UC units
Introduction to Linguistics
No Folsom Lake College equivalent — complete after transfer.
SPAN 1
5 UC units
First-Year Spanish
Take at Folsom Lake College: SPAN 401 or SPAN 402
SPAN 2
5 UC units
First-Year Spanish
Take at Folsom Lake College: SPAN 402 or SPAN 401
FREN 1
5 UC units
First-Year French
Take at Folsom Lake College: FREN 402 or FREN 401
FREN 3
5 UC units
First-Year French
Take at Folsom Lake College: FREN 412 or FREN 411
FREN 2
5 UC units
First-Year French
Take at Folsom Lake College: FREN 401 or FREN 402
